Pick two examples from your life- family, school, work or community and share an example of: diversity inclusion and diversity exclusion.
Answer-) Example for diversity inclusion -
My school being an international school enrolls students from all over the world, and it respects the cultural diversity hence, children from different cultural backgrounds are welcomed and taught together. Every student is given equal opportunity to participate in events and all the religious festivals are celebrated excitingly. I've many friends from different backgrounds, some are Christian, some follow Buddhism and some are athiest, and we all respect each other's culture and embrace this diversity.
Example for diversity exclusion -
There's a religious community near my house which works for the welfare of catholic members of our society . This community has isolated itself from other religions, and strictly follows their norms and their own affirmation of faith. Members of this community discuss ideas which have a strong religious context and sometimes they may disrespect the ideas of other religions making it a community which is not open to diversity.
